Position: Privileged Access Management Operations Engineer-1

Job Description:

Pacific Life is investing in bright, agile and diverse new talent to contribute to our mission of innovating our business and creating a superior customer experience. We're actively seeking a talented Identity and Access Management (IAM) Operations Engineer who will be responsible for the delivery of the Privileged Access Management (PAM) products and capabilities required to support the enterprise infrastructure and business line applications.

In this role you will implement and support the PAM strategy and corresponding roadmaps considering the corporate strategy, industry security trends and regulatory requirements. You will also collaborate and coordinate with other IT leaders, technologists and support staffs to ensure the requirements are clearly defined and established timelines are met. Finally, you will work to improve and track the maturity of the PAM products and services showing increased adoption, speed to market, and resiliency.

This is a fully onsite role in either our Newport Beach, California or Charlotte, North Carolina office.

How you’ll help move us forward:
  • Serve asa Privileged Access Management Engineer
  • Support program strategy and multi-year plan incorporating all parts of PAM: scan/discovery, remediation, lifecycle management, password rotation, password vaulting, just in time administration
  • Design, develop and troubleshoot PAM solutions with the ability to provide technical and architectural design documentation, recommendations, specifications, use cases, requirements and test cases
  • Work collaboratively to create solutions that drive full automation, self-service, and resiliency
  • Eliminated duplicative capabilities where possible, reduce complexities, and leverage enterprise standards and industry best practices
  • Define best practice and development of troubleshooting processes, methodologies, standards, alerts and reporting from PAM platform(s) to be leveraged for operational monitoring
  • Identify, manage and remediate existing or future risks, issues, and roadblocks for timely delivery
  • Partner with internal technical teams ensuring the strategy and roadmaps are well understood while monitoring successful implementation
  • Lead change, by acting as change agent, to use skills inspire a shared purpose of intent, drive awareness, communications, documentation, and training
  • Experience with enterprise password manager solutions (such as Keeper) to support secure credential storage
The experience you bring:
  • 10+ years Information Security experience, with strong focus in IAM PAM platforms (e.g. Delinea, Cyber Ark, Netwrix)
  • Detailed knowledge and experience in enabling new, migrating to, and/or managing an enterprise PAM platform based on best practices.
  • Detailed knowledge and experience with automating PAM processes by leveraging out of box capabilities and custom build connectors / APIs.
  • Hands-on experience with PAM across multiple infrastructure operating systems including Oracle & MS SQL databases, Windows, and Linux.
  • Knowledge and experience of Just-in-Time Administration and Zero Trust.
  • Ability to leverage programming languages to build custom automation and tooling that enhance PAM efficiency and reliability.
  • Experience with Agile methodologies and corresponding Agile based tools.
  • Ability to manage complex activities simultaneously to short timescales.
  • Ability to demonstrate continuous improvement.
What makes you stand out:
  • BA/BS in Information Systems, Computer Science or related field
  • CISSP, CISM, CISA or other relevant security certifications and knowledge of ISO and NIST security standards preferred
